The hatchback 5 doors SEAT Ibiza 2006 - 2008 year modification 2.0 MT (115 hp)

Engine

Engine type petrol
Engine location front, transverse
Engine capacity, cm³ 1984
Boost type No
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m 115 / 85 at 5400
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m 170 at 2400
Cylinder arrangement in-line
Number of cylinders 4
Number of valves per cylinder 2
Engine power supply system distributed injection
Compression ratio 10.5
Cylinder diameter and piston stroke, mm 82.5 × 92.8

General information

Brand country Spain
Car class B
Number of doors 5

Performance indicators

Fuel consumption, l city / highway / combined 11 / 6 / —
Fuel type Super (95)
Maximum speed, km/h 198
Acceleration to 100 km/h, s 10.1

Sizes in mm

Length 3977
Width 1698
Height 1441
Wheelbase 2460
Ground clearance 130
Front track width 1435
Rear track width 1424
Wheel size 205 / 45 / R16

Suspension and brakes

Type of front suspension independent, spring
Type of rear suspension independent, spring
Front brakes disk ventilated
Rear brakes disc

Transmission

Transmission mechanical
Number of gears 5
Drive type front

Volume and weight

Fuel tank capacity, l 45
Curb weight, kg 1128
Trunk volume min/max, l 265 / 1030
Gross weight, kg 1648

SEAT Ibiza 2.0 MT (115 hp): A Compact Hatchback with Spanish Flair

The SEAT Ibiza 2.0 MT (115 hp) is a compact hatchback that combines practicality, performance, and style. Produced between 2006 and 2008, this model is a testament to SEAT's commitment to delivering reliable and efficient vehicles. With its 5-door hatchback design, the Ibiza is perfect for urban commuting and weekend getaways alike. Its Spanish heritage adds a touch of Mediterranean charm, making it a standout in the B-class car segment.

Performance and Efficiency

Under the hood, the SEAT Ibiza 2.0 MT boasts a 2.0-liter petrol engine that delivers 115 horsepower and 170 Nm of torque. This engine, paired with a 5-speed manual transmission, ensures a smooth and responsive driving experience. The car acc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in 10.1 seconds, reaching a top speed of 198 km/h. While it may not be the fastest in its class, it offers a balanced mix of power and efficiency. Fuel consumption is reasonable, with 11 liters per 100 km in the city and 6 liters on the highway, making it a cost-effective choice for daily driving.

Design and Dimensions

The SEAT Ibiza's compact dimensions make it ideal for navigating tight city streets. Measuring 3977 mm in length, 1698 mm in width, and 1441 mm in height, it strikes a perfect balance between space and maneuverability. The 2460 mm wheelbase ensures a comfortable ride, while the 130 mm ground clearance provides adequate clearance for most road conditions. The 16-inch wheels with 205/45 R16 tires add to the car's stability and grip, enhancing both safety and performance.

Interior and Cargo Space

Inside, the SEAT Ibiza offers a surprisingly spacious cabin for a compact car. The 5-door configuration provides easy access to both the front and rear seats, making it a practical choice for families. The trunk offers a minimum volume of 265 liters, which can be expanded to 1030 liters by folding down the rear seats. This flexibility makes it suitable for everything from grocery runs to weekend trips. The fuel tank capacity of 45 liters ensures fewer stops at the pump, adding to the car's convenience.

Suspension and Braking

The SEAT Ibiza is equipped with an independent spring suspension system, both at the front and rear, ensuring a comfortable and stable ride. The ventilated front disc brakes and rear disc brakes provide reliable stopping power, enhancing safety in various driving conditions. These features, combined with the car's lightweight design (curb weight of 1128 kg), contribute to its agile handling and responsive braking.
